CodeSpeak: Nuevo lenguaje promete bases de código más pequeñas

Fuentes: New Programming Language CodeSpeak Aims to Shrink Codebases by Up to 10x

Un nuevo lenguaje de programación llamado CodeSpeak ha sido presentado, con el objetivo de reducir significativamente el tamaño de las bases de código, hasta en un factor 10. Desarrollado con tecnología de modelos de lenguaje grandes (LLMs), CodeSpeak se posiciona como una herramienta para ingenieros y equipos que construyen sistemas complejos, priorizando la comunicación y el mantenimiento de especificaciones sobre el código en sí. La plataforma, aún en fase de vista previa alfa, permite la integración de código generado y escrito manualmente, facilitando proyectos mixtos.

Según los estudios de caso publicados, CodeSpeak ha logrado reducir el tamaño del código en proyectos de código abierto como yt-dlp, Faker, BeautifulSoup4 y MarkItDown. Por ejemplo, en el soporte de subtítulos WebVTT para yt-dlp, el tamaño del código se redujo de 255 líneas a 38, un factor de 6.7x, con un aumento mínimo en el número de pruebas fallidas. El equipo detrás de CodeSpeak planea introducir una funcionalidad que permita convertir código existente en especificaciones más pequeñas y manejables, simplificando el mantenimiento y la comprensión del software.